As the industry seeks to optimize drilling processes and ensure safety, understanding the function and significance of casing couplings becomes paramount.Well casing is a robust steel pipe installed in boreholes to provide structural stability, preventing the collapse of the well and protecting the surrounding environment from contamination. Casing couplings, in turn, serve as the connections between individual casing pipes. These couplings are engineered to safeguard each segment, ensuring a seamless transfer of pressure and load throughout the drilling process.
The design and material of casing couplings play a crucial role in their performance. Typically made from high-strength steel, couplings must withstand extreme conditions, including high pressures, corrosive environments, and significant mechanical loads. Common threading designs include API (American Petroleum Institute) and premium threads, which enhance connection reliability and reduce the risk of leaks, a concern that could have dire consequences both environmentally and economically.
One of the primary functions of casing couplings is to provide a secure seal, reducing the likelihood of any fluids—whether from the drilling process or the surrounding geological formations—escaping into the environment. This is essential not only for safeguarding the aquifers and ecosystems surrounding drilling sites but also for maintaining the integrity of the well, preventing blowouts that could result in catastrophic failures.
